Oh, you mean the ECJ that stopped us deporting Abdul Hamza? That ECJ.

No, it wasn't the ECJ, it was the ECHR.

https://infacts.org/two-courts-muddle/

Critics of the EU have repeatedly cited decisions of the ECHR to justify their criticisms of the EU, despite the two organisations being entirely separate. The Daily Telegraph still has an article on its website from 2010 headlined “Abu Hamza extradition halted by EU judges”, which then reports an ECHR judgment. The ECHR was set up after World War Two to act as a guardian of the rights of Europe’s citizens. Forty-seven European countries, including Russia and Turkey as well as the UK, have signed up to the ECHR. The EU’s Court of Justice adjudicates on the interpretation of treaties and legislation.
